Autumn 2026 Professional Internship | Launch Your Career with Entertainment Technology Partners
Pixl is seeking motivated and curious college students for our Autumn 2026 Professional Internship Program. This 16 week paid internship offers hands on experience working behind the scenes in the entertainment technology industry. Interns will work alongside experienced professionals and gain exposure to real projects that support live events, touring productions, broadcast, and technical services.
This program is designed to help students explore potential career paths, build professional skills, and develop valuable industry connections. Internship opportunities may be available in areas such as Show Services, Marketing, Accounting, Education, Live Events, Touring, and Technical Services.
